Town Board Workshops

Town Board Workshops are held at 4:30 p.m. in the Town Hall Lower Level Meeting Room on Monday prior to Town Board Meetings, unless otherwise advertised. In the event there is a holiday on Monday, the Workshop is typically held on the Tuesday prior to the Town Board Meeting. What happens at a Town Board Workshop?

Following a meeting with Department Heads and the Town Supervisor, the Town Clerk's Office prepares a draft Workshop Agenda that is uploaded to the Town website the Friday before a Town Board Meeting and sent to the Town Board for review; the Workshop Agenda is finalized prior to the meeting.

At the Workshop, the Town Supervisor, Town Board Members, and Department Heads are present for extended discussions on topics as requested by the Town Board. While the meeting is open to the public to view and listen, there is not an opportunity for public comment.

After each Town Board Workshop, minutes are prepared and sent to the Town Board for review. Upon approval of the Workshop Minutes by the Town Board at a subsequent meeting, these minutes are uploaded to the Town website.
